Purpose and Objective:  
Callidus Software, Inc. seeks a BTP Customer Success Partner Senior Advisor at our San Ramon, CA location to engage with an assigned portfolio of customers with the goal of driving customers to leverage BTP as the platform-of-choice for integration, extension, innovation and analysis scenarios of the Intelligent Enterprise. 

 

Expectations and Tasks: 
Responsible for developing relationships with technical decision makers to ensure that SAP customers' consumption of the BTP Cloud services grows in alignment with SAP (Intelligent Enterprise) strategy. Engage customers to activate their initial adoption, and promote retention and loyalty. Partner with customers to sustainably increase consumption of SAP Business Technology Platform (BTP) services, coordinate activities with the Account Team by building out a joint outcome-based plan, and drive a mutual understanding of IT-Architecture and business value. Understand the big picture, deliver expertise with digital transformation, and advise on technical and business architectures. Act as the primary SAP BTP strategic point of contact and orchestrate success resources across SAP and customers by leveraging assets of the SAP BTP engagement model. Analyze customers' technical needs and execute consumption plans for the assigned customers. Provide recommendations and prepare the customer to make the best use of the solution, in alignment with SAP strategy and roadmap. Serve as a voice of the customer to internal SAP stakeholders. Work with colleagues from a broad variety of groups such as Cloud Success Services life-cycle relevant centers of experts, Account Teams, Pre-sales Teams, Product Management Groups, Support Teams, Services Teams, and Partners. Fulfill the premium subscription services of the assigned customers. 

 

Education and Occupational Experience: 
Bachelor’s degree or foreign equivalent in Computer Science, Mathematics, Engineering, or a related field of study and six (6) years of progressive post-baccalaureate experience in the job offered or related occupation. Alternatively, a Master’s degree or foreign equivalent in Computer Science, Mathematics, Engineering, or a related field of study and four (4) years of experience in the job offered or related occupation.

 

Qualifications/Skills and Competencies Experience: 
Experience must involve three (3) years in the following: 
•    Operations and production support for SAP Commissions, Callidus TrueComp & Incentive Management;
•    Designing, building, & testing compensation plans in SAP Commissions, Callidus TrueComp & Incentive Management;
•    Designing, building & testing analytical reports;
•    Database/SQL, including Oracle;
•    Designing and implementing data loads; and
•    Designing, implementing & executing test plans that include unit, regression, system integration & user acceptance testing in manual and automated testing.
